Nothing is cheap in the detecting field.

Maybe you can get a second hand Minelab Xterra for around $800. ven detectors 4 and 5 years of age still sell for around $3000. Have a look in Trading Post or Ebay for a bargain

MMMM for a good one you are looking $3,000 to $6,000 $175 would be low end. Having said that I once saw a guy work an area with a top end detector when a family turned up with an el cheapo dick smith detector.

The family found an old tin box the gold detector did not register, it contained all sorts of old coins and stuff probably a few thousand dollars worth. Luck of the draw I guess !
